黑狐家游戏

建立索引属于数据库的什么步骤,数据库索引的创建步骤与注意事项

欧气 1 0

本文目录导读:

  1. 建立索引的步骤
  2. 建立索引的注意事项

数据库索引是数据库系统中一个非常重要的概念,它能够显著提高数据查询的效率,在数据库中,建立索引是优化查询性能的关键步骤,本文将详细介绍建立索引的步骤以及注意事项,帮助读者更好地理解和应用数据库索引。

建立索引的步骤

1、确定索引字段

在创建索引之前,首先要确定索引字段,索引字段应满足以下条件:

建立索引属于数据库的什么步骤,数据库索引的创建步骤与注意事项

图片来源于网络,如有侵权联系删除

(1)经常作为查询条件的字段;

(2)字段数据量较大,且查询操作频繁;

(3)字段值具有唯一性或部分唯一性。

2、选择索引类型

数据库索引类型主要有以下几种:

(1)单列索引:只针对一个字段创建索引;

(2)组合索引:针对多个字段创建索引,字段顺序很重要;

(3)全文索引:适用于文本字段,能够提高文本查询的效率。

根据实际需求选择合适的索引类型。

3、创建索引

在确定了索引字段和索引类型后,可以使用以下SQL语句创建索引:

(1)创建单列索引:

建立索引属于数据库的什么步骤,数据库索引的创建步骤与注意事项

图片来源于网络,如有侵权联系删除

CREATE INDEX index_name ON table_name(column_name);

(2)创建组合索引:

CREATE INDEX index_name ON table_name(column_name1, column_name2, ...);

4、检查索引效果

创建索引后,需要检查索引效果,以确保索引能够提高查询效率,可以使用以下SQL语句检查索引效果:

EXPLAIN SELECT * FROM table_name WHERE column_name = 'value';

EXPLAIN关键字可以显示查询执行计划,从而判断索引是否被有效利用。

5、优化索引

如果发现索引效果不佳,可以尝试以下优化方法:

(1)调整索引字段顺序;

(2)删除不必要的索引;

(3)使用部分索引;

建立索引属于数据库的什么步骤,数据库索引的创建步骤与注意事项

图片来源于网络,如有侵权联系删除

(4)创建复合索引。

建立索引的注意事项

1、避免对大量数据创建索引

在创建索引时,要避免对大量数据创建索引,因为索引会占用额外的存储空间,并且会增加数据插入、删除和更新的成本。

2、避免创建过多的索引

过多的索引会导致数据库性能下降,因为数据库需要维护这些索引,建议根据实际需求创建适量索引。

3、选择合适的索引类型

根据实际需求选择合适的索引类型,对于数值字段,可以选择B树索引;对于文本字段,可以选择全文索引。

4、定期维护索引

数据库使用过程中,索引可能会出现碎片化现象,影响查询性能,需要定期对索引进行维护,使用OPTIMIZE TABLE语句对表进行优化。

建立索引是数据库优化的重要步骤,能够显著提高查询效率,在创建索引时,要充分考虑索引字段、索引类型等因素,并注意避免一些常见问题,通过本文的介绍,相信读者已经对建立索引有了更深入的了解,在实际应用中,不断优化索引,提高数据库性能,是数据库管理员的重要任务。

标签: #建立索引属于数据库的什么

黑狐家游戏
  • 评论列表

留言评论